Most small businesses run referrals by telling happy customers "just mention our name." The problem: you have no idea if it's working, who to reward, or which customers are your best advocates.

Tips that make it work
- Ask at the right moment. The best time to ask for a referral is right after the positive experience — at checkout, end of session, or when a customer compliments you.
- Keep the offer simple. "Refer a friend, get $10 off your next visit" is more compelling than complex tier systems. Simple wins.
- Display the QR where people wait. At the register, in the waiting area, or on a receipt. Idle moments are referral moments.
- Review your top referrers weekly. Knowing who your best advocates are lets you thank them personally and turn them into VIPs.
